They had to do a few things to get my dollar this year: Improve the gameplay, improve recruiting, and do Louisville justice on the rosters.

1.) Improve Gameplay: C - As far as I can tell they improved DB play in man. They improved QB accuracy (by making it less accurate), and they made the speed of the game more realistic. I still don't feel like the pocket exists, zones aren't done properly at times, run blocking and downfield blocking is still bad, and human d-line preassure is still non-existant. Madden has done so much more, things that weren't "risks" in gameplay but straight improvements. To not steal them is dumb.

2.) Improve Recruiting: B - I think the ability to downplay other schools is terrific. I still feel much more could have been done.

3.) Louisville's Roster: F- - They seriously had to try to screw up or roster this bad. It's just beyond awful and broken. Regardless if this is the "screw up" roster or not, it's just sickening how completely inaccurate they have our rosters. Makes me want to vomit.
